Michael Holley co-hosts the 'Dale and Holley' mid-day show on WEEI.Holley first came on the Boston sports scene as a writer for the Boston Globe. After leaving to work in Chicago briefly, he returned to Boston. Holley has appeared on ESPN's 'Around the Horn' and the dreadful, now cancelled, 'I Max' with Max Kellerman on Fox Sports.
Michael wrote the story of the 2002 and 2003 New England Patriots in the book Patriot Reign, which made the New York Times best-seller list. Holley was granted unprecedented access to the inner-workings of the Patriots, and Bill Belichick in particular. The book covers the up and down 2002 season following the team's first Super Bowl, and the return to glory in Super Bowl XXXVIII.
Holley went on to replace Bob Neumeier as Dale Arnold's co-host on WEEI in 2004.
